"I need to compute the eigevector belonging to the maximum eigen value."
Why is SVD being used? Just use eig?
o=eye(3);
z=zeros(3);
A= [o -o z z;
z -o o z;
z -o z o;
-o z o z;
o z z -o;
z z o -o];
m = ones(size(A,1),1)*1;
Q = diag(m.*m);
Qxx=pinv(A'*inv(Q)*A)';
Qdd=2*Qxx;
[V,D] = eig(Qdd,'vector');
D.'
ans = 1×12
0.5000 -0.0000 0.5000 0.5000 0.0000 0.0000 0.5000 0.5000 0.5000 0.5000 0.5000 0.5000
Lot's of repeated eigenvalues. Which one is considered the maximum eigenvalue?
